AMERICAN SIGN AND INDICATOR CORP. v. SCHULENBURG

Nos. 12509-12511.

267 F.2d 388 (1959)

AMERICAN SIGN AND INDICATOR CORPORATION,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. Edward J. SCHULENBURG et al., etc., Defendants-Appellees. TIME-O-MATIC, INC., Plaintiff-Appellee, v. AMERICAN SIGN AND INDICATOR CORPORATION, Defendant-Appellant. TIME-O-MATIC, INC., Plaintiff-Appellant, v. AMERICAN SIGN AND INDICATOR CORPORATION, Defendant-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als Seventh Circuit.

Rehearing Denied July 9,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Wilfred S. Stone, Chicago, Ill., Cameron Sherwood, Walla Walla, Wash., Henry S. Wise, Danville, Ill., for American Sign & Indicator.

Charles B. Spangenberg, Chicago, Ill., Donald S. Baldwin, Danville, Ill., Sidney Wallenstein, Chicago, Ill., for Schulenburg, Time-O-Matic.

Before SCHNACKENBERG, HASTINGS, and KNOCH, Circuit Judges.


KNOCH, Circuit Judge.
